Pour les serveurs gérés dans le Control-Center

Nous vous montrons comment augmenter un volume existant sur votre serveur.

Ainsi, vous pouvez modifier le partitionnement en fonction de vos souhaits.

Veuillez noter : Cet article décrit des changements profonds à apporter au système de fichiers de votre serveur. Avant d'augmenter la taille du volume existant, effectuez une sauvegarde pour éviter toute perte de données.

Pour vérifier la taille du volume logique (logical volume) et sa capacité disponible, entrez la commande suivante :

vgdisplay -v vg00

La capacité disponible est affichée au niveau de la ligne Free PE / Size.

Vous pouvez agrandir le volume à l'aide de la commande lvextend. Si vous voulez utiliser tout l'espace disque disponible pour le volume, entrez la commande lvextend au format lvextend -l +100%FREE /dev/VOLUMEGROUP/LOGICALVOLUME. Exemple :

[root@9794c2d ~]# lvextend -l +100%FREE /dev/vg00/var
Size of logical volume vg00/var changed from 10.00 GiB (2560 extents) to 399.19 GiB (102192 extents).
Logical volume home successfully resized.

Pour augmenter un volume logique (logical volume) de 10 Go, tapez la commande lvextend au format suivant :

lvextend -L +10G /dev/VOLUMEGROUP/LOGICALVOLUME

Dans l'exemple ci-dessous, un volume logique (logical volume) passe de 4 Go à 14 Go :

root@localhost ~]# lvextend -L +10G /dev/vg00/var

Après avoir entré la commande, le message suivant s'affiche :

Extending logical volume var to 14.00 GB
Logical volume var successfully resized

Pour afficher les systèmes de fichiers des partitions, entrez la commande blkid.

blkid

Veuillez noter : Le système de fichiers apparaît à la fin de la ligne après l'entrée TYPE=.

Exemple :

/dev/md1: LABEL="root" UUID="1aff71de-fa12-44c2-8d2d-cd51cb0eb19b" TYPE="ext3"

Pour pouvoir utiliser l'espace de stockage supplémentaire, vous devez agrandir le système de fichiers. Le tableau ci-dessous donne des exemples pour les différents systèmes de fichiers.

Système de fichiers Exemple Caractéristiques spéciales
Ext 2,3,4 resize2fs /dev/vg00/var  
ReiserFS resize_reiserfs -f /dev/vg00/var  
JFS mount -o remount,resize /var Depuis Kernel 2.6 la nouvelle taille du volume est donnée en blocs (dans cet exemple la commande est : mount -o remount, resize=1048576 /var ).
XFS xfs_growfs /var  

Enfin, vous pouvez immédiatement vérifier le changement avec la commande df :

Pour vérifier les modifications apportées au volume logique (logical volume), tapez la commande suivante :

df -h /var/